What instrument is used to measure the rate of flow of an electric current?

The milliampere meter is a specific instrument designed to measure the flow of electric current, particularly in milliamperes. This is particularly important in the field of esthetics, where low levels of current are often used for various treatments, such as microcurrent therapy. The milliampere meter provides precise readings of small currents, making it ideal for monitoring and ensuring safety during cosmetic procedures that employ electrical devices.

Other instruments, although related to electricity, serve different purposes. A voltmeter measures the electric potential difference (voltage) across two points, which does not directly indicate current flow. A wattmeter measures power in watts, which is a product of voltage and current but does not provide a direct measurement of current flow itself. An ohmmeter is used to measure resistance in an electrical circuit, which again does not relate directly to the measurement of current. Thus, the milliampere meter is the correct choice for measuring the rate of flow of an electric current.
